On 2009/02/10, at 6:01 PM, Mason James wrote:

> Hi Koha developers,
>
> I have been talking with John and Paul at BibLibre for some months  
> now about a
> correct way to add Data::Dumper, Smart::Comments,  
> insert::your::favorite::debugger stuff
> to the Koha perl files *once and for all*
>
>
> After a few false starts and some googling - this is the method I  
> have used and tested...
>
>
> use C4::Debug;
> use if $debug, 'Data::Dumper' ;
> use if $debug, 'Smart::Comments' ;
> # use if $debug, 'YAML::Dumper;   # etc....
>

> Is there a better way than this?


A question from me too..

Is there a clever way to add this code to *just* Debug.pm which would  
enable D::D and S::C functionality to all perl files that 'use  
C4::Debug'?

That would be the cleanest way, i think - but i don't know how to do  
this, or if it's possible in perl :/
